课程核心技术体系
技术方向 | 核心框架 | 技术亮点 |
---|---|---|
Web开发 | Gin/Beego/Iris | 快速构建高性能API服务 |
分布式系统 | rpcx | 支持跨语言服务调用 |
微服务架构 | go-micro | 插件化开发模式 |
实战型课程架构
课程体系设计遵循企业实际开发场景,基础语法阶段融入云原生开发理念,通过容器化部署案例帮助学员建立现代开发思维。中阶课程重点突破并发编程与网络通信模块,结合电商系统秒杀场景进行实战演练。
项目驱动式教学
每日课程设置对应开发任务,采用代码评审机制确保学习质量。阶段性项目涵盖从单体架构到微服务改造全过程,重点解决服务拆分、链路追踪等企业级开发难题。
职业发展体系
- 技术评估: 每月进行代码质量审查与架构设计能力测评
- 面试实训: 真实技术面谈场景还原,破解算法题与系统设计难点
- 职业护航: 三年内免费提供技术升级课程与推荐
技术深度拓展
高阶课程包含云原生技术栈集成,涉及Docker容器编排与Kubernetes集群部署实战。特别设置性能优化专题,通过pprof工具链分析系统瓶颈,提升学员解决复杂工程问题的能力。
教学服务承诺
开发环境云端备份:支持多设备无缝切换开发
代码仓库管理培训:Git工作流规范与企业级实践
技术文档写作指导:培养开源项目贡献能力